The front washer bottle tank supplies the rear wiper washer as well as the front. This is common on most cars. If the system is completely empty it will take a few seconds before the washer will spray the rear windscreen after it is refilled due to the longer distance the fluid has to travel. Once done it should work instantly.

It is explained on page 62 of the Owners manual. The right hand lever on the steering column operates the front & rear wipers. Push the button on the end of the lever to operate the rear wiper. Push the lever towards the dashboard to operate the rear washer. There is a graphic on the top of the lever that shows this. Pulling the lever towards you operates the front washer.

If you get nothing then your reservoir is empty. Fill it up with some washer additive and if it still is not working go back to the dealer & get it fixed.

Rear Windscreen Wash and Wipe*

When the START/STOP switch is in the
ACC/ON/RUNNING position, the rear wipers and
washers can operate.


INSTRUMENTS AND CONTROLS
Intermittent Wipe

Press the intermittent wipe button and release, the wipers
will wipe three times at once, then intermittently wipe,
and press the intermittent wipe button again to turn off
the intermittent wiping. Toggling the automatic wipe speed
adjustment switch can adjust the time period between the
Intermittent wipes.
Wash/Wipe
By pulling the lever switch towards the instrument, the rear
window washers will operate immediately.
The wipers continue operating for a further three wipes
after the lever is released. After several seconds, there will
be a further wipe to remove any fluid draining down the
screen.
Note: When the tail gate is opened, rear wiper
operations will be disabled.
Note: After the windscreen wipers are switched on, if
the shift lever is in “R” position, the rear wiper will
operate.
